    BORGES AND THE INFINITE TANGO
    Tango, Buenos Aires, the hoodlums and guitar are issues that are reiterated in the work of Jorge Luis Borges.
    The idea of this show is to cross the music of great composers like Salgán, Delfino, Troilo, Piazzolla, Greco, Bardi, De Caro, Arolas, Carlevaro Aroztegui Tuegols and the words of the great writer, in a game where the spoken voice is as an instrument, like a voice and guitar duo, also the guitar, so these related texts, seems also to speak and say other things, or the same otherwise. It then involves a conversation in which language plays as music and the guitar is also involved as lenguaje.Y in which Borges speaks about a thousand ways to “Infinite Tango” (As he says in his sonnet “Sonnet for a tango that evening, “published in the magazine” Faces and Masks “in 1926)
